Blinker bulb keeps burning out

Guys
The front drivers side blinker bulb (parking lamp) keeps burning out the filament and I cant get it to blink. The socket that was in there was all rusted out and full of water.

I replaced the socket and installed a new bulb and it kinda worked as a parking lamp. As soon as I hit the headlights the bulb goes out and stops working, all the other bulbs work and blink, including the side marker lamp.

My friend said that its shorting out somewhere in the headlight circuit, but I am not sure where to look for the short.
